Know Your Medical History Before You Walk In
Examiners will ask about every broken bone, surgery, medication, and vision correction you’ve ever had. This isn’t nostalgia—it’s liability and safety filtering. They need to know if you had a head injury in third grade because repeated head trauma affects vestibular balance, which matters when you’re pulling Gs in an F-16. They ask about your childhood ear infections because chronic infection history signals potential inner ear problems that show up during the balance station.
Start by gathering these documents now, not the day before your exam:
- Surgical records from any procedure, no matter how minor (including appendicitis, ACL repair, hernia fixes)
- Orthodontic records if you had braces—yes, really, they want to know about that
- Vision correction history (every prescription change, laser eye surgery dates, contact lens brands you’ve worn)
- Medication list spanning the past five years, including over-the-counter stuff and supplements
- Hospital discharge summaries for any ER visits
- Pediatrician records documenting childhood injuries and illnesses

For vision correction specifically, write down the exact dates of any LASIK, PRK, or other refractive surgery. The military cares about how long post-op you are because healing affects visual acuity. If you had PRK in the last six months, you might not be cleared yet. They’ll ask whether you wear glasses, contacts, or both, and which correction you use for driving. Be honest here—lying about needing glasses when you actually do is grounds for permanent disqualification. Don’t make my mistake.
Sleep and Hydration the Week Before
Most candidates think they should arrive rested the day of the exam. That’s half right. What actually matters is seven days of consistent sleep leading into test day.
Your vision testing depends on tear production and retinal health. Dehydration destroys both. Starting five days before your exam, drink a minimum of 3.5 liters of water daily — that’s roughly 14 cups. Not coffee. Not energy drinks. Water. Your urine should be nearly clear by day three. If it’s still dark yellow on exam day, you’re still dehydrated. This affects contrast sensitivity testing and depth perception measurements.
Sleep timing matters more than total hours. Your balance testing uses your vestibular system, which gets sluggish when you’re sleep-deprived. Aim for eight hours minimum, with consistent bedtimes. If you normally sleep 11 p.m. to 7 a.m., maintain that schedule all week. Shifting to 10 p.m. to 6 a.m. on exam week confuses your body’s calibration. What to Eat (and What to Avoid)
Your diet in the week before affects your blood pressure, vision clarity, and energy during testing. The exam lasts 2-4 hours depending on whether you need additional stations or retesting.
Stop consuming caffeine three days before your exam. Caffeine raises blood pressure temporarily, and many candidates fail their cardiovascular screening because they had coffee that morning. The exam measures resting blood pressure. If you consume caffeine, you’re not resting. One large coffee can raise systolic pressure by 10-15 mmHg — enough to push you over the Navy’s 140/90 threshold (Army uses 160/100 for initial screening). I know pilots who drink coffee every morning of their lives, but they learned to skip it exam day. They actually started skipping it the week before to reset their baseline.
Eat normally but predictably. Avoid extreme diet changes the week of testing. Your body needs stable blood sugar for vision focus and balance. That means eating three regular meals with protein and complex carbs. No skipping breakfast. No “fasting” to look lean. Your cardiovascular assessment includes an EKG that can look abnormal if you’re hypoglycemic.
The morning of the exam, eat a light breakfast 2-3 hours before arrival: oatmeal with banana, or scrambled eggs with toast. This stabilizes blood sugar without making you feel full during the vision station. Avoid high-fat or greasy foods — they slow digestion and can make you feel nauseated during spinning balance tests. It sounds silly, but nausea during the balance exam is common enough that examiners expect it. They’ll have you retest, and if you’re uncomfortable in your stomach, you’ll fail the retest too.
Salt intake matters. Stable sodium levels support consistent blood pressure. Don’t go salt-free, and don’t binge on salty foods. Eat normally. The Exam Room By Room Breakdown
Most military flight physicals follow a similar sequence. Knowing what happens at each station removes anxiety and helps you mentally prepare.
Vision Station (first, lasts 15-20 minutes)
You’ll read eye charts at 20 feet and near distance, identify color plates (Ishihara test), and do depth perception testing (usually a Howard-Dolman apparatus — you adjust a rod while looking through a viewfinder). The military requires 20/40 correctable vision in each eye, or 20/20 in one eye if the other is 20/40. Depth perception must be 67 seconds of arc or better (this measures how precisely you can judge distance).
Prep tip: the day before and day of the exam, practice focusing on distant objects. Look out a window at trees or buildings far away for 5-10 minutes. This trains your ciliary muscles and reduces eye strain during prolonged focus. Wear your glasses or contacts exactly as prescribed — don’t try contact lenses if you normally wear glasses just because you think it looks better.
Hearing Station (10 minutes)
Audiometric testing in a soundproof booth. You’ll hear tones at various frequencies and raise your hand when you hear them. The military standard is hearing thresholds at or better than 25 decibels across standard frequencies (500, 1000, 2000, 3000 Hz). Hearing loss over 25 decibels can disqualify you.
Prep: avoid loud noise exposure for 24 hours before the exam. No concerts, construction sites, or shooting ranges. Let your ears recover. If you work in a loud environment, wear earplugs the entire week before testing.
Balance and Coordination Station (10-15 minutes)
Romberg test (stand with feet together, eyes closed). Dix-Hallpike maneuver (head positioning to assess vertigo). Walk a straight line. Usually some kind of spinning test — you sit in a rotating chair while tracking lights or objects, then the chair stops and you track movement again. This tests your vestibular system’s ability to maintain orientation.
Dizziness during testing doesn’t automatically fail you, but you’ll be asked to retest. If you feel dizzy, inform the examiner immediately — they’ll have you sit, recover, and try again. Pushing through dizziness looks like you’re hiding a condition, which looks worse than disclosing it.
Cardiovascular Station (20-30 minutes)
EKG, blood pressure check, and usually a step test or treadmill. They’re looking for arrhythmias, abnormal EKG patterns, and whether your heart rate recovers appropriately after exercise. Blood pressure under 140/90 systolic/diastolic is the Navy standard; Army uses 160/100 for initial screening.
Prep: exercise regularly the week before, but don’t exhaust yourself the day prior. Consistent moderate activity (30 minutes walking, running, or cycling) the week before makes your cardiovascular system look stable and healthy.
Orthopedic and General Physical (20-25 minutes)
Range of motion testing, strength assessment, flexibility checks. They’re screening for conditions that might worsen under G-forces or affect your ability to eject from an aircraft. They’ll ask you to bend forward, touch your toes, squat, and move your arms through ranges.
Prep: stretch daily the week before. Not aggressively — just 10-15 minutes of gentle yoga or static stretching. This improves range of motion and prevents muscle tightness that makes movement look restricted on exam day.
Red Flags That Might Delay Your Certification
Some conditions are waiverable. Some aren’t. Knowing the difference prevents wasted time chasing approvals that won’t come.
Likely Waiverable (with documentation)
Prior stress fractures if fully healed. Mild color blindness (depends on severity and branch). History of asthma if well-controlled and not exercise-induced. Some knee injuries with surgical repair and full recovery. Previous concussion more than 12 months ago. These require additional documentation but typically don’t prevent certification.
Often Non-Waiverable
Active ear infections or untreated hearing loss. Uncontrolled hypertension. Recent head injuries (less than 12 months). Certain cardiac arrhythmias. Psychotropic medication use (antidepressants, anti-anxiety drugs). Uncorrected vision beyond correctable limits. These require consultation with an aerospace medicine specialist before you even submit to the flight physical, because the exam itself might disqualify you permanently if it shows the condition.
If you’re unsure whether you have a disqualifying condition, contact the aerospace medicine section of your local military medical facility before booking your flight physical. A consultation costs nothing and can clarify whether you need to wait for a condition to resolve or pursue a waiver first.
